British Airways Avios / Miles Estimator
Use this BA miles calculator to estimate how many Avios you could earn from a trip based on distance, cabin, status, and promotions.
Tip: For connecting flights, count each leg as a separate segment.
What is a BA miles calculator?
A BA miles calculator helps you estimate how many points you can earn through British Airways flights and eligible partner travel. Even though many people still say “BA miles,” the current reward currency is Avios. The point of the calculator is simple: before you book, you can get a realistic estimate of your return on spend and compare ticket options more confidently.
If two flights are priced similarly, the one with better Avios earning might be the better long-term choice. This is especially useful for frequent travelers who are trying to build balance for upgrades, reward flights, or part-payment options.
How this BA miles calculator works
The calculator above uses a practical model based on distance and multipliers. It is designed to be fast, transparent, and easy to tune.
- Distance: The one-way route mileage (or km converted to miles).
- Segments: Number of one-way flights in your itinerary.
- Cabin multiplier: Premium cabins generally earn more than discounted economy fares.
- Status bonus: Bronze, Silver, and Gold members can earn additional Avios.
- Promo bonus: Add temporary campaigns like “+25% Avios.”
Because British Airways and partners can apply specific fare rules, this is an estimate. However, it’s usually directionally accurate enough to support planning and comparison.
Quick formula
Total Avios ≈ (Distance × Segments × Cabin Multiplier) + Status Bonus + Promotional Bonus
Then we estimate monetary value based on your chosen pence-per-Avios assumption.
Example scenarios
Scenario 1: Economy round-trip with no status
You fly 3,450 miles each way, nonstop, in standard economy:
- Distance: 3,450 miles
- Segments: 2
- Cabin multiplier: 1.0
- Status: Blue (0%)
Estimated Avios: 6,900 before promotions.
Scenario 2: Business class with Silver status
Same distance and segments, but in business class at 150% earning plus Silver status bonus:
- Base Avios: 3,450 × 2 × 1.5 = 10,350
- Status bonus (50%): +5,175
- Total (before promo): 15,525
This illustrates why status and cabin can materially change your return on travel.
How to use your estimate for better booking decisions
Once you estimate your Avios, compare flights using effective net cost rather than fare alone. For example, if one ticket costs £40 more but earns 6,000 extra Avios, it may still be a better deal depending on your valuation.
- Set a realistic Avios value (commonly around 0.8p to 1.2p, depending on redemption).
- Compare nonstop vs connecting options (more segments can alter earnings).
- Review partner airline earning rates before booking codeshares.
- Check for limited-time promotions and registration requirements.
Tips to maximize BA Avios over time
1) Focus on earning stacks
Large balances are built by stacking: flight Avios + elite bonuses + co-branded card spend + shopping portal offers. Small incremental gains compound quickly if you travel regularly.
2) Keep your redemption target clear
Know whether you want short-haul reward seats, premium cabin upgrades, or long-haul redemptions. Your goal changes how you value Avios and where you earn them.
3) Don’t ignore taxes and fees
A “free” flight can still include cash charges. The best redemption is not always the one with the lowest Avios price, but the one with the best overall value.
4) Watch fare classes
Two economy tickets can earn different amounts depending on booking class. If Avios matter to you, verify earning details before purchase.
Common questions
Are BA miles and Avios the same thing?
Most people use “BA miles” informally, but British Airways uses Avios as its reward currency.
Is this an official British Airways tool?
No. This page is an educational estimator designed to help with planning and comparisons.
Why might actual Avios differ from the estimate?
Actual earnings can vary due to fare class exclusions, partner airline policies, ticketing channel rules, and temporary program changes.
Final thoughts
A good BA miles calculator helps you move from guesswork to strategy. Instead of asking “How many points might I get?”, you can ask better questions: “Which ticket maximizes value?” and “How quickly can I reach my next redemption goal?” Use the estimator before you book, tweak scenarios, and choose flights that support your long-term travel plans.